>> > The DBx500 and ABx500 should be getting their IRQs from the
>> > device tree and nowhere else. Get rid of all the static assignments
>> > everywhere, delete it from the driver, platform data and the
>> > board files in one swift strike.
>> >
>> > Lots of cross-dependencies in the MFD drivers for PRCMU and
>> > AB8500 makes it necessary to strike everywhere at once to
>> > eradicate IRQs passed as resources and platform data to the left
>> > and right around the platform.
